An heirloom pumpkin from pre-Civil War America. Highly productive with a great classic shape. Traditionally intercropped with corn. Despite its weak stems, it remains a reliable variety. Ideal for culinary or decorative purposes. C. pepo. Endangered. 85 dtm. 15 seeds per package.

C. pepo. The Cornfield Pumpkin is an heirloom treasure with roots tracing back to pre-Civil War America. Renowned for its exceptional productivity and impressive, classic shape, this variety has been cherished for generations. With a maturity time of 85 days, it remains a reliable choice for both historical preservation and modern cultivation.

Though its stem lacks the robust strength of more modern hybrids, the Cornfield Pumpkin makes up for it with its unparalleled charm and yield. Ideal for intercropping with corn, as was traditionally practiced, this pumpkin embodies the spirit of old-time farming. Whether used for culinary delights, fall decorations, or heritage gardens, the Cornfield Pumpkin offers a genuine connection to the agricultural past.
